Originally, Whitacre composed the music for a setting of Robert Frost’s iconic poem, "Stopping by Woods on a Snowy Evening." The piece was commissioned by Julia Armstrong in memory of her parents, who shared a deep love for the poem.

The piece by Eric Whitacre is a renowned choral work originally set to Robert Frost's poem Stopping by Woods on a Snowy Evening , but later re-set to original lyrics by Charles Anthony Silvestri due to copyright issues. 📄 Key PDF Resources sleep+eric+whitacre+pdf
